Whitewater, February 13, 2025 -

A rollover incident involving a white Ford F150 occurred today on the eastbound lanes of Interstate 10 near State Route 62 in Whitewater, CA. The California Highway Patrol received reports of the accident at approximately 9:03 PM, with emergency services responding promptly to the scene.

Initial reports indicated that the driver lost control of the vehicle, resulting in the rollover. Fortunately, no injuries were reported, and the situation was managed effectively without significant impact on traffic flow. The California Highway Patrol later confirmed that the incident was categorized as a traffic collision with no injuries.

By 9:35 PM, a tow truck was called to assist with the removal of the overturned vehicle. Authorities reported that the roadway remained clear and did not experience any major disruptions, allowing traffic to continue moving smoothly.
